WEST LAFAYETTE, IN—Engineers at Purdue University recently designed a roadway that wirelessly charges heavy-duty electric trucks driving at highway speeds.

OAK RIDGE, TN—Researchers at Oak Ridge National Laboratory have developed a 20-kilowatt wireless charging system for electric vehicles. The system is said to be three times more efficient than plug-in systems.
